Are you ready to maximise the power of your 6.7L Powerstroke while also enhancing the exhaust sound? The MBRP Performance Exhaust System is designed to improve exhaust flow, enhance sound, and deliver the performance your truck should have had from the factory. Built specifically for trucks equipped with the 6.7L Powerstroke, this system replaces the factory DPF exhaust with a high-flow 4-inch design that allows exhaust gases to exit more efficiently. The result is improved engine breathing, reduced restriction, and a deeper exhaust tone that adds character without being overly aggressive, making it ideal for daily driving, towing, or performance-minded builds. With its single side-exit configuration and improved exhaust flow, this system helps your diesel truck perform and sound the way a heavy-duty Powerstroke should. MBRP offers a strong balance of performance, durability, and value. The system features smooth mandrel-bent 4-inch tubing that maintains a consistent diameter through every bend to maximize exhaust flow and efficiency. Designed to install using factory hanger locations, this exhaust system provides a straightforward bolt-on installation while maintaining proper alignment and fitment. A CARB-approved downpipe is included for compliant performance upgrades where applicable. With its rugged construction, precision bends, and complete hardware kit, this MBRP exhaust kit delivers reliable performance, improved exhaust tone, and long-lasting durability for your 6.7L Powerstroke truck.

MBRP offers many kits in both single and dual outlet configurations. While the performance gains are the same for duals and single systems, the duals offer a deeper more aggressive sound over the single system. This is due to the extra tail pipe and the fact that most dual systems have a slightly different muffler configuration than the single systems.

MBRP even manufactures their "Smokers" kits, which are single and dual in-bed STACK kits to deliver to the hardcore enthusiasts! These kits are available in an assortment of sizes and styles, such as 5" and 6", with turnouts and mitre (angle) cuts. Smokers kits are even available in the new popular BLACK finish for that truly sinister look!!!

The muffler used on all of MBRP's diesel systems is a straight flow through design with a spiral louver core. The muffler is packed with stainless steel wool which is then wrapped with a ceramic fibre blanket to ensure longevity of the muffler. This combination creates the deep mellow exhaust note that MBRP systems are known for.

While performance gains vary depending on the vehicle, you can expect a gain of 5% to 10% in horsepower and torque. For example, with a 2005 GM Duramax diesel, you will see a gain of 18 HP. and 28 ft/lbs measured at the rear wheels. You can also expect a reduction in exhaust gas temperature (EGT) by approximately 200 Degrees F.
